Visiting Philadelphia Metro Area

Philadelphia sports fans have renewed hope as the Philadelphia Eagles season ends and the 76ers now take the court. Join the crowds at the Wells Fargo Center in downtown Philly to cheer on the Sixers for the shortened yet 2012 season. The Philadelphia Flyers are mid-season, also at the Wells Fargo Center; catch the action on the ice into April. This is also the season for film buffs to take in the various genres of film presented by the Philadelphia Jewish Film Festival. Presented by the Gershman Y, the PJFF embarks on its 30th year in 2012. Sports, arts, culture and of course history – Philly delivers it all.

For a special treat when visiting Philadelphia, make reservations for the Chinese New Year Banquet prepared by local celebrity chef Joseph Poon. Located in Philly’s Chinatown, enjoy a traditional 10-course Chinese New Year Banquet celebrating the year of the dragon. For a spectacular evening, join chef Poon January 22nd on Chinese New Year’s Eve for a Tasting Tour through Chinatown. Visit Philadelphia’s Chinese Bakery, Asian Grocer and the fortune cookie factory, followed by the New Year Banquet and midnight celebration.

Allentown, 60 miles north of Philadelphia, is home to the Da Vinci Science Center. Through March, the Da Vinci offers winter visitors an adventure in form and Function with Keva Build It Up! Fun for all ages, visitors enjoy an interactive design and building challenge using KEVA planks. If you have a Cub Scout in the family check the Da Vinci Camp-in schedule where kids overnight at the science center while working on scouting badges.

When the snow flies in Eastern Pennsylvania, Allentown and the Lehigh Valley are where you want to be. Ski, snowboard or tube in Pennsylvania’s Appalachian Mountains. Blue Mountain north of Lehigh Valley and South Mountain to the south make great winter getaways. Bear Creek Mountain Resort and Blue Mountain Ski Area offer a great variety of terrain for snow sports and family fun.

West of Philadelphia two hours, is the city of York. Laying claim to the coolest place in town is the York City Ice Arena. An ideal place for winter skating, York City Ice Arena is home to White Rose Figure Skating Club and York Ice Hockey Club. With two ice rinks, a pro shop snack bar and game room; this is the place for fun. There is even a Fitness Center and community room upstairs. The arena schedule features plenty of time for open skating – lace up the blades and enjoy some winter fun in York.
